Gurwin Jewish Nursing And Rehabilitation Center

Commack, Suffolk County, New York · CCN 335696 · Non-profit (Corporation) · not part of a chain

CMS rates Gurwin Jewish Nursing And Rehabilitation Center 5 of 5 overall as of August 2026. 460 certified beds, 433 residents a day on average. 17 citations on record from the current inspection cycles, 1 involving actual harm; no fines on record.
